Amazon trims Kindle price tag to $299

Published: Wednesday, July 8, 2009 8:20 p.m. MDT
 |  E-MAIL | PRINT | FONT + - 

NEW YORK (AP) — Amazon.com Inc. cut the price of its Kindle electronic reading device to $299 on Wednesday in an effort to attract more bookworms and make the gadget a mainstream hit.

The new price is $60 below the tag the Kindle has had since May 2008. The product originally debuted at $399 in 2007.

Amazon spokeswoman Cinthia Portugal said the price cut, a classic move in electronics marketing, is not just a short-term promotion.

"We've been able to increase the volume of Kindles we're manufacturing and decrease the cost of doing so," Portugal said.

Amazon has not disclosed Kindle sales figures, and the publishing industry has said e-books account for less than 1 percent of book sales.
